Desmond and Andres are on the edge of their seats in this twenty-fifth installment of Desmond Cole Ghost Patrol series!
Grab some popcorn and sodatheres a double feature playing at the Kersville movie theater! But when the monster from the movie literally jumps out from the screen, its up to the Ghost Patrol to send it home before the end credits roll. Double the movies, double the scares!
With easy-to-read language and illustrations on almost every page, the Desmond Cole Ghost Patrol chapter books are perfect for emerging readers.
Andres Miedoso is still afraid of everything as a grown-up, even after all his adventures with Desmond Cole. He lives in New York City with his family, and he remains best friends with Desmond but returns to Kersville only when hes needed.
Victor Rivas was born and raised in Vigo, Spain, and he lives outside of Barcelona. He has been a freelance illustrator for thirty years, illustrating childrens and teen books, comics, and concept art for multimedia games and animation.
